A historical official title for a higher-ranking civil servant who administered a specific administrative district (an 'Amt') on behalf of a territorial ruler. His duties often included jurisdiction, administration, and tax collection.
example
Im Mittelalter war der Amtmann der höchste Vertreter der landesherrlichen Gewalt in seinem Bezirk.
In the Middle Ages, the Amtmann was the highest representative of the territorial ruler's authority in his district.

Word composition
The word is made up of 'Amt' (an official position or authority) and 'Mann' (man). So it literally describes a man who holds a public office.

Historical term
This is a historical official title that is no longer used for active civil servants today. You find the word mainly in historical texts or when talking about earlier administrative structures.

Word family
'Amtmann' belongs to the word family around 'das Amt' (authority, office/post). Other related words are 'amtlich' (official, confirmed by an authority) and 'der Beamte' (a person who works in the public service).

Amtmann vs Verwalter
administrator
'der Verwalter' and 'der Amtmann' can both have to do with administration. However, a Verwalter is a general and normal word today for a person who looks after or organizes something for others. 'Amtmann', by contrast, is mainly a historical or former official title. It referred to a civil servant with certain administrative duties or a certain rank. Learners may confuse the words because both sound like administration and official responsibility. In everyday situations today, you almost always say 'Verwalter'. 'Amtmann' fits mainly in historical texts or when talking about old administrative structures.
